Crime Trends in Morse, WI
Examining recent data reveals that Morse experiences typical rural crime patterns, including:
- Property Crimes: Break-ins, vehicle thefts, and trespassing are the most common issues.
- Vandalism and Mischief: Occur sporadically, often related to seasonal outdoor activities.
- Wildlife and Environmental Incidents: Not crime per se, but important for safety awareness in rural areas.
Safety Tips for Morse Residents and Visitors
While Morse is generally safe, staying vigilant is key. Consider these safety tips:
- Regularly Review Crime Data: Keep an eye on the crime map and local news updates.
- Report Suspicious Activity: Contact Vilas County authorities if you notice unusual behavior.
- Secure Your Property: Lock doors, windows, and vehicles, especially during the off-season.
- Engage with the Community: Participate in local neighborhood watch programs and community events.
